Class of 2026 Berean Baptist Academy (N.C.) forward Justin Caldwell has received an offer from Division I St. Bonaventure Men’s basketball program, today he wrote on X.
Additionally, the 6-foot-9, 240-pound four-star player has been heating up the basketball recruiting circuit, with several offers from DI schools the likes of NC State, Northeastern, Maryland, Georgetown, Villanova, Butler, Memphis, among others, per VerbalCommits.com.
Caldwell, who also suits up for the Washington Warriors AAU squad, due to his size, is extremely hard to stop down low. Plus, he owns a nice jump shot, is a three-level scorer, and plays defense well.
Moreover, scouts believe that he is just beginning to hit his stride, with some room to improve his overall game.
The Bonnies posted a 22-12 overall record and went 9-9 in Atlantic 10 Conference action in the 2024-25 campaign.
